QuantumScape Corporation, commonly referred to as QS, is a prominent player in the electric vehicle (EV) battery technology sector. Founded in 2010, the company has garnered significant attention for its innovative approach to solid-state battery technology, which promises to revolutionize energy storage solutions for electric vehicles. Unlike traditional lithium-ion batteries, QuantumScape’s solid-state batteries utilize a solid electrolyte instead of a liquid one, which can potentially lead to higher energy density, faster charging times, and improved safety.
This technology positions QuantumScape as a key contender in the rapidly evolving EV market, where the demand for efficient and sustainable energy solutions is surging. The company went public in late 2020 through a merger with a special purpose acquisition company (SPAC), which allowed it to raise substantial capital to fund its ambitious research and development initiatives. Historical Performance of QS Stock
Since its debut on the public market, QS stock has experienced a rollercoaster ride, marked by significant highs and lows. Initially, the stock surged dramatically following its public listing, driven by excitement surrounding the potential of solid-state battery technology and the growing interest in electric vehicles. In early 2021, QS stock reached an all-time high of around $132 per share, fueled by optimism about the future of EVs and QuantumScape’s partnerships with major automotive manufacturers like Volkswagen.
This meteoric rise was indicative of a broader trend in the market, where investors were eager to capitalize on the green energy revolution. However, as with many high-growth tech stocks, the euphoria was short-lived. By mid-2021, QS stock began to decline sharply as investors reassessed their expectations and the broader market faced headwinds from rising interest rates and inflation concerns.
The stock’s price fluctuated significantly throughout 2022 and into 2023, reflecting both company-specific developments and macroeconomic factors. Despite these challenges, QuantumScape has continued to make strides in its technology development and has maintained a strong focus on scaling production capabilities. Analysis of QS Stock’s Technology and Innovation

At the heart of QuantumScape’s value proposition is its groundbreaking solid-state battery technology. Traditional lithium-ion batteries rely on liquid electrolytes, which can pose safety risks due to flammability and thermal runaway. In contrast, QuantumScape’s solid-state batteries utilize a solid electrolyte that not only enhances safety but also allows for higher energy density.
This means that vehicles powered by QuantumScape batteries could potentially travel longer distances on a single charge compared to those using conventional batteries. The company’s proprietary technology has undergone rigorous testing and validation. In 2021, QuantumScape announced that its solid-state battery cells had achieved a remarkable milestone: they could operate at room temperature while maintaining high energy density and cycle life.
This breakthrough is critical for commercial viability, as it addresses one of the primary challenges associated with solid-state batteries—performance at ambient temperatures. Furthermore, QuantumScape’s partnership with Volkswagen has provided it with valuable resources and expertise in automotive manufacturing, enabling the company to accelerate its research and development efforts. In addition to its core technology, QuantumScape is also focused on scaling production capabilities.
The company has announced plans to build a manufacturing facility in San Jose, California, which is expected to produce solid-state battery cells at scale. This facility will play a pivotal role in meeting the anticipated demand from automotive partners and will be instrumental in driving down production costs over time. Market Potential and Competition for QS Stock
The market potential for QuantumScape’s solid-state battery technology is immense, particularly as the global automotive industry shifts towards electrification. According to various industry reports, the electric vehicle market is projected to grow exponentially over the next decade, with estimates suggesting that EV sales could reach over 30 million units annually by 2030. This surge in demand presents a significant opportunity for QuantumScape to capture market share with its advanced battery solutions.
However, competition in the battery technology space is fierce. Established players like Panasonic, LG Chem, and CATL are investing heavily in research and development to enhance their own battery technologies. Additionally, several startups are emerging with innovative approaches to energy storage solutions.
For instance, companies like Solid Power and Ionic Materials are also working on solid-state battery technologies that could rival QuantumScape’s offerings. The competitive landscape necessitates that QuantumScape not only continues to innovate but also effectively communicates its unique value proposition to potential customers. Moreover, partnerships with major automotive manufacturers will be crucial for QuantumScape’s success in this competitive environment.
The collaboration with Volkswagen is a significant step forward; however, expanding partnerships with other automakers will be essential for scaling production and achieving widespread adoption of its technology. Analyzing QuantumScape’s financial health reveals both challenges and opportunities for growth. As of late 2023, the company has yet to generate significant revenue from product sales due to its focus on research and development. This lack of revenue generation is not uncommon for companies in the early stages of technological innovation; however, it does raise questions about cash flow sustainability.
QuantumScape has relied on capital raised through its SPAC merger and subsequent funding rounds to finance its operations. Investors should closely monitor QuantumScape’s cash burn rate as it ramps up production capabilities. The company’s ability to manage expenses while investing in growth initiatives will be critical in determining its long-term viability.
Additionally, any delays in production timelines or setbacks in technology development could impact investor sentiment and stock performance. On a more positive note, QuantumScape’s partnerships with established automotive manufacturers provide a pathway for future revenue generation. As these partnerships mature and production begins at scale, there is potential for significant revenue growth.
Analysts project that if QuantumScape can successfully commercialize its solid-state batteries within the next few years, it could capture a substantial share of the burgeoning EV battery market. Regulatory and Legal Considerations for QS Stock

As an emerging player in the battery technology sector, QuantumScape must navigate a complex landscape of regulatory and legal considerations that could impact its operations and growth prospects. The electric vehicle industry is subject to various regulations aimed at ensuring safety, environmental sustainability, and consumer protection. Compliance with these regulations is essential for gaining approval from automotive manufacturers and regulatory bodies.
One significant regulatory consideration is related to environmental standards for battery production and disposal. As concerns about climate change intensify, governments worldwide are implementing stricter regulations regarding emissions and waste management in manufacturing processes. QuantumScape must ensure that its production methods align with these standards while also addressing sustainability concerns associated with lithium extraction and battery disposal.
Additionally, intellectual property (IP) protection is crucial for QuantumScape as it seeks to maintain its competitive advantage in solid-state battery technology. The company must actively safeguard its patents and proprietary technologies from infringement while also navigating potential legal challenges from competitors claiming similar innovations. A robust IP strategy will be essential for protecting QuantumScape’s innovations and ensuring its long-term success in a competitive market.
Future Outlook and Potential Risks for QS Stock
Looking ahead, the future outlook for QS stock hinges on several key factors that could influence its trajectory in the coming years. The successful commercialization of QuantumScape’s solid-state battery technology will be paramount; any delays or technical challenges could dampen investor enthusiasm and impact stock performance. Investors should closely monitor milestones related to production scaling and partnerships with automotive manufacturers.
Market dynamics also play a crucial role in shaping QuantumScape’s future prospects. The electric vehicle market is subject to fluctuations based on consumer demand, government incentives, and competition from alternative energy sources such as hydrogen fuel cells or other battery technologies. A slowdown in EV adoption or shifts in consumer preferences could pose risks to QuantumScape’s growth potential.
Moreover, macroeconomic factors such as inflation rates, interest rates, and supply chain disruptions can impact both production costs and consumer purchasing power. These external factors may create volatility in QS stock performance as investors react to changing economic conditions.
